Alexander Faribault House
Museum
Photo: McGhiever,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The Alexander Faribault House is a historic house museum in Faribault, Minnesota, United States. Built in 1853, it was the first wood-frame house constructed in Rice County, Minnesota. Alexander Faribault House is situated 1,900 feet southwest of St. Mary’s Hall.

Faribault
Photo: AlexiusHoratius,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Faribault is a city in Southern Minnesota. It is the county seat of Rice County and located at the confluence of the Cannon and Straight rivers.
Cannon City
Village
Cannon City is an unincorporated community in Cannon City Township, Rice County, Minnesota, United States, five miles northeast of Faribault. The community is located at the junction of Rice County Road 20 and Crystal Lake Trail. Cannon City is situated 3½ miles northeast of St. Mary’s Hall.
